Lovecraft Country is an upcoming supernatural thriller series set to debut on HBO, from executive producers Misha Green and Jordan Peele. It follows a young African-American man searching for his father, who stumbles on a mysterious legacy along the way. As hinted by the title, we can expect some ghoulish Lovecraftian experiences from the show.
Several of Lovecraft Country’s stars gathered for a Comic-Con@Home panel to promote the show, including Jonathan Majors, Courtney B. Vance, Jurnee Smollett, Abbey Lee, Aunjanue Ellis, Michael Kenneth Williams, and Wunmi Mosaku.
In addition to the panel, HBO released a sneek peek from the show, featuring Majors’ Atticus Black, Smollett’s Letitia Dandridge, and Vance’s George Black exploring a darkened museum. You can watch below to see what they uncover.
Lovecraft Country will premiere on HBO August 16th, with 10 episodes expected for its first season.
